Bryndle - unreleased studio track

What the Gypsy Said
recorded 1997

This is something special - a completed unreleased Bryndle song (written by Karla Bonoff, Wendy Waldman and Kenny Edwards) with lead vocals by Karla Bonoff. This song was played live by Bryndle in 1996-97 and was first recorded in early 1997 with vocals and other overdubs added later that year. All intentions were that it would be included in Bryndle's second CD, "House of Silence." It has a nice pop feel more reminiscent of Karla's 1970's recordings than Bryndle. It was briefly released on a special "limited-run" disc sent out to record companies but never released to the public. Then in 2001, another attempt was made to re-record the song, but it was eventually pulled from the list. This is the 1997 version of the song - released for the first time. The lyrics to this song can be found on Karla Bonoff's site here. Although specific credits are sketchy, the musicians include Karla, Kenny and Wendy plus Scott Babcock and probably Matt Cartsonis. Andrew Gold was probably not on this track.
